    New Years Resolve; Binge or Be


    by: Betsy L. Angert

    Fri Jan 01, 2010 at 00:00:00 AM EST

    FdBrn

    copyright © 2009 Betsy L. Angert.  BeThink.org

    Another year has come and gone.  Everywhere she goes she hears people speak of New Years resolutions.  They all say this time will be different.  I will decide to do as I had not done previously or at least had not done well.  Countless commit to a life of calorie counting.  Others merely muse that they will exercise more.  Drugs, drinking, there are also discussions of these concerns.  People are confident.  This year I will deliver myself from what I think evil.  A few philosophize as to their personal career path.  Change is the objective.  A greater goal is thought to be golden.  As Author Mary Anne Radmacher reflected and now millions whisper as their mantra, "Live with intention . . .  Choose with no regret. . . . Do what you love. Live as if this is all there is."  Therein lies the problem.

    Calories Do Not Count. Cellular Considerations Do


    by: Betsy L. Angert

    Thu May 18, 2006 at 17:50:00 PM EDT

    copyright © 2006 Betsy L. Angert

  • Written in Response to those at Daily Kos that thought the earlier post might be lost in the mania of Monday Morning.

    Dear reader, you may have read one of my earlier exposé on health, habits, feelings, and fats, Weight. Balancing Fat with Feelings, Habits With Health ©.  Perhaps you saw my missive on soda, Childhood Obesity. Adult On-Set Diabetes. Osteoporosis. Soda ©.  In that piece, I discussed the deleterious effects of simple sugars, caffeine, and carbonation.  In many discussions, I spoke of eating and weight.  I offered that body image was not the cause of many poor eating programs.  These treatises might have caught your attention or not.  Nevertheless, in a world where people are obsessed with topics such as these, I offer some more thoughts on the subject.

    People ponder, "How many calories might I eat or burn?  Will exercise bring me bliss?  What is my heart rate, my blood pressure, and how are my Triglycerides?  What is my HDL, [High Density lipoproteins] or LDL [Low-density lipoproteins]?  Is my glucose level good?"  BMI [Body Mass Index] is an important concern, or is it.  I contend our weight may not be the issue.  Calories are not the contribution that counts, cellular considerations do.
